1. Choosing the Right Dental Professional
Finding a qualified and experienced dentist is paramount when considering root canal treatment. Patients should start by researching dental professionals who specialize in endodontics—dentists who are trained specifically in root canal procedures. Checking their credentials and certifications is a crucial first step towards ensuring safe treatment.
Moreover, personal recommendations from friends, family, or even general dentists can lead to excellent choices. Online reviews also provide insight into the dentists reputation and the experiences of other patients, making it easier to assess whether a specific dental professional is trustworthy.
Finally, a preliminary consultation can be very informative. During this meeting, patients can ask about the dentists approach to root canal treatment, including the techniques and technologies employed, giving them a clearer picture of what to expect.
2. Assessing Risks and Potential Benefits
Understanding the risks associated with root canal treatment is essential for making an informed decision. While the procedure is generally safe, potential complications such as infection, damage to adjacent teeth, or incomplete removal of the infected tissue can occur. Being aware of these risks prepares patients for possible outcomes and encourages them to ask their dentist questions.
On the other hand, it is equally important to consider the benefits of undergoing root canal treatment. Preserving the natural tooth significantly contributes to overall oral health, enabling effective chewing and maintaining proper alignment of surrounding teeth. Additionally, root canal treatment can prevent the spread of infection, protecting other areas of the mouth and maintaining overall systemic health.
Evaluating both risks and benefits allows patients to weigh their options rationally. This consideration can ease anxiety related to the procedure and highlight the importance of addressing dental issues before they escalate.
3. Preparing for the Treatment Procedure
Preparation is vital for ensuring a successful root canal treatment. Patients should follow their dentist’s instructions regarding pre-treatment care, which may include fasting or avoiding certain foods a few hours before the procedure. This preparation can minimize potential complications and elevate the overall comfort during the treatment.
Additionally, discussing any ongoing medications or health conditions with the dentist is essential. Providing a comprehensive health history allows the professional to tailor their approach and select appropriate anesthetics or antibiotics, particularly for patients with pre-existing conditions.
Lastly, considering transportation arrangements post-treatment is an often-overlooked aspect of preparation. Since patients may experience fatigue or sedation effects, having a friend or family member available to assist can help ensure a smooth recovery process.
4. Planning Post-Treatment Care and Recovery
Post-treatment care is a critical component of successful recovery following root canal therapy. Patients should adhere to their dentist’s recommendations regarding pain management and oral hygiene practices. Over-the-counter pain relief medication may be suggested to manage any discomfort.
Following the procedure, it’s crucial to maintain oral hygiene by gently brushing and flossing, as well as attending any follow-up appointments scheduled with the dentist. This proactive approach promotes healing and prevents further complications.
Furthermore, patients should monitor their condition in the days following the treatment. If unusual symptoms arise, such as prolonged pain or swelling, reaching out to the dentist immediately is critical to address potential concerns swiftly and effectively.
